  • How do I get to downtown Los Angeles from Los Angeles International Airport?

    The FlyAway airport bus service outside the main Terminal building is the cheapest and most convenient transportation option from LAX to downtown Los Angeles if you don’t have much luggage. It connects the airport to Union Station, Westwood, Van Nuys, Hollywood, and Santa Monica. The ride to downtown LA is around 30 minutes. You can also take the free shuttle bus connecting to LA's Metro system. Other options include taxis, shuttles, ride apps, and car rentals.

  • At what point is a flight considered delayed from Palm Springs to Los Angeles?

    A flight is considered delayed when it departs 15 minutes or more after its scheduled time. This is the standard used by the US Department of Transportation and most airline industry reporting. On the Palm Springs to Los Angeles route, 9% of flights were delayed in the past 3 months, with delays averaging 1 hour 53 minutes.

  • United Airlines and Alaska Airlines, the major providers on this route, have no maximum carry-on weight limit. However, your carry-on bag shouldn’t exceed 22 x 14 x 9 inches (including wheels and handles) and fit in the overhead compartment. You can also bring 1 personal item onboard both airlines, which must fit under the seat in front of you.

  • The Palm Springs International Airport (PSP) has different services for travelers with reduced mobility. You’ll find volunteer navigators at key locations to help you find your way around. Other services include airport parking & curbside service, wheelchair service, and TSA security checkpoint assistance.
